- Lila (Hinduism) - Wikipedia
Lila (Sanskrit: लीला līlā) or leela ( ˈliːlə ) can be loosely translated as "divine play" The concept of lila asserts that creation, instead of being an objective for achieving any purpose, is rather an outcome of the playful nature of the divine
